2 de Mayo is a football club based in Pedro Juan Caballero, Paraguay, playing their home matches at Estadio Monumental Río Parapití. Follow 2 de Mayo on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, squad information, transfer news, and comprehensive performance analytics.

Alexis Fariña has been the standout performer for 2 de Mayo in league play this season with a rating of 7.14. Marcelo Acosta and Sergio Sanabria have also impressed with ratings of 6.89 and 6.88 respectively.

Diego Acosta leads 2 de Mayo's scoring in league play with 5 goals this season. Matías Cáceres has contributed 3, while Rodrigo Ruiz Díaz has added 2.

Alexis Fariña is the chief creator for 2 de Mayo in league play with 3 assists this season. Alan Gómez and Pedro Delvalle have also been key playmakers with 2 and 2 assists respectively.

2 de Mayo have been in solid form recently, winning 2 of their last 5 matches (40% win rate). They have scored 6 goals and conceded 4 during this period. Defensively, they have been solid, conceding an average of 0.8 goals per game. In the Division Profesional, their recent results include a 2-2 draw with Guarani, a 2-1 win against Sportivo Trinidense, a 2-0 win against Rubio Nu, a 0-0 draw with Libertad, and a 0-1 loss to Sportivo San Lorenzo.

2 de Mayo's squad consists of 28 players. Goalkeepers: Ángel Martínez (Paraguay), Miguel Urquiza (Paraguay), Juan Armoa (Paraguay). Defenders: Wilson Ibarrola (Paraguay), René Rodríguez (Paraguay), Camilo Saiz (Colombia), Ulises Coronel (Paraguay), Alberto Espínola (Paraguay), César Castro (Paraguay), Pedro Sosa (Paraguay). Midfielders: Denis Rodríguez (Paraguay), Brahian Ayala (Paraguay), Sergio Sanabria (Paraguay), Óscar Romero (Paraguay), Alexis Fariña (Paraguay), Henry Riquelme (Paraguay), Hosue Díaz (Paraguay), Alan Fernandez (Paraguay), Alvaro Montiel (Paraguay), Luis Delgadillo (Paraguay). Forwards: Alan Gómez (Paraguay), Alan Veiga (Paraguay), Pedro Delvalle (Paraguay), Matías Cáceres (Paraguay), Sergio Fretes (Paraguay), Diego Acosta (Paraguay), Fabricio Brener (Argentina), Félix Triñanes (Argentina).

2 de Mayo transfers: New signings include Marcelo Acosta (from Rosario Central).

Eduardo Ledesma is the current head coach of 2 de Mayo. Under their leadership, the team has achieved a 23% win rate across 22 matches, averaging 1.00 points per game.

Previous managers include Marcelo Palau managed the club for one season, recording 3 wins from 18 matches (17% win rate). Felipe Giménez managed the club for one season, recording 8 wins from 26 matches (31% win rate).

2 de Mayo plays their home matches at Estadio Monumental Río Parapití in Pedro Juan Caballero, which has a capacity of 22,000.
